The first female partner in Mintz’s Los Angeles office and a member of the firm, Arameh Zargham O’Boyle is a trailblazing litigator for the cosmetics and personal care products industry. Recognized for three consecutive years in the Los Angeles Business Journal’s “Leaders of Influence: Minority Attorneys” list, she defends product manufacturers in complex class actions and product liability litigation. O’Boyle provides strategic counsel on advertising, labeling and regulatory compliance, with a deep focus on the Modernization of Cosmetics Regulation Act (MOCRA). Her recent successes include defending numerous beauty brands against PFAs claims and representing a medical device manufacturer in a complex Multi- District Litigation (MDL) that consolidated over 200 product liability cases. As chair of the ABA Mass Torts Subcommittee and a leader in Mintz’s products liability group, she shapes legal strategy across the industry. An immigrant, O’Boyle is a dedicated mentor who volunteers annually at a Title One school, sharing her journey to inspire the next generation of leaders.
